Abstract

The invention provides a kind of bean-grinding coffee machine, owing to brewing system includes: brewage housing and perforation and milling cutter parts for place coffee bean capsule;Perforation and milling cutter parts have initial position and an abrasion site relative to above-mentioned housing of brewageing: when perforation and milling cutter parts relative to above-mentioned brewage housing be positioned at initial position time, perforation and milling cutter parts are positioned at the outside of the coffee bean capsule abrasive areas brewageing housing;When perforation and milling cutter parts relative to above-mentioned brewage housing be positioned at abrasion site time, perforation and milling cutter parts be positioned at rotating grinding bean in the coffee bean capsule abrasive areas brewageing housing.Thus, perforation and milling cutter parts at least one operating position pierce through capsule surface and allow perforation and milling cutter parts rotate, hot-water heating system is sprinkle hot water in described brewing system.In whole work process coffee bean try one's best few exposure in atmosphere, improve coffee quality, there is wide market prospect.

Background technology
Traditional bean-grinding coffee machine, the coffee bean of conventional bag packaging or canned as brewing materials, user tears open After opening packaging, coffee bean taking out a part and puts into coffee machine, the quality of remaining coffee bean deteriorates rapidly, The quality of coffee causing to brew is the best.Meanwhile, this bean-grinding coffee machine is inconvenient to use, and essentially consists in: one is User can not add coffee bean accurately in coffee machine, and two is that the coffee bean taking out bag packaging adds coffee machine After, then the sack containing residue coffee bean is stored, it is a more complicated process, adds user Manufacturing process.Therefore, provide the user the good coffee bean capsule of quantitative package and be suitable for this coffee bean capsule Bean-grinding coffee machine structure, be a direction of improved product.
Summary of the invention
The technical problem to be solved is to provide a kind of bean-grinding coffee machine, it is possible to utilizes and is contained in glue Coffee prepared by coffee bean in capsule, easy to use, and the shelf lives of coffee bean is long.

Detailed description of the invention
The present invention is to solve problem of the prior art, it is proposed that a kind of bean-grinding coffee machine, as Fig. 1,2, bag Include organism 1, hot-water heating system 28, control system and brewing system, hot-water heating system 28 and brewing system It is arranged on body 1;Hot-water heating system 28 includes hot water outlet, connects with brewing system;Control system bag Include heating control module, be electrically connected with hot-water heating system;Wherein, described brewing system includes: be used for That places coffee bean capsule 21 brewages housing 20 and perforation and milling cutter parts 29;Described brewing system Include: brewage housing and perforation and milling cutter parts for place coffee bean capsule;Described perforation And milling cutter parts 29 have initial position and abrasion site relative to described housing 20 of brewageing: work as perforation And milling cutter parts 29 relative to described brewage housing 20 be positioned at initial position time, perforation and milling cutter Parts 29 are positioned at the outside of the coffee bean capsule abrasive areas brewageing housing 20;When perforation and milling cutter portion Part 29 relative to described brewage housing 20 be positioned at abrasion site time, perforation and milling cutter parts 29 be positioned at wine Make rotating grinding bean in the coffee bean capsule abrasive areas of housing 20.
Embodiment one:
In the present embodiment, as shown in Figures 1 to 6, described brewing system includes: be used for driving perforation and grinding Knife milling tool parts carry out the propulsive mechanism 31 moved back and forth between initial position and abrasion site;Described pusher Structure 31 is connected with perforation and milling cutter parts 29;When perforation and milling cutter parts 29 are positioned at initial position Time, perforation and milling cutter parts 29 are positioned at the outside of the coffee bean capsule abrasive areas brewageing housing 20; When perforation and milling cutter parts 29 are positioned at abrasion site, perforation and milling cutter parts 29 are positioned at and brewage Rotating grinding bean in the coffee bean capsule abrasive areas of housing 20.
The brewing system of bean-grinding coffee machine also includes: mill bean motor 9, driving gear 10 and driven gear 11, Driving gear 10 is arranged on mill bean motor 9 output shaft, and driven gear 11 connects with driving gear 10 engagement; Perforation and milling cutter parts 29 are co-axially mounted with driven gear 11;Perforation and milling cutter parts 29 include Rotating shaft 22 and cutterhead 23, rotating shaft 22 and cutterhead 23 is had to fasten installation, perforation and grinding knife in coaxial fashion Tool parts 29 move up and down in two working position range along vertical direction, and it mainly has two working positions Putting, first job position is referred to as initial position A, and second operating position is referred to as abrasion site B.
Brewage housing 20 for a kind of coffee basket.
Hot-water heating system 28 include water tank 2, water outlet of water tank 6, heating element heater water inlet pipe 7, heating element heater 8, First hot-water line 5, connecting tube 4 and the second hot-water line 3;Water outlet of water tank 6 is positioned at bottom water tank 2, water tank Outlet 6 connects heating element heater 8 by heating element heater water inlet pipe 7;Connecting tube 4 is arranged on the casing of water tank 2 Going up or be fixed on body 1, heating element heater is by the first hot-water line 5, connecting tube 4 and the second hot-water line 3 Connection brewing system also carries hot water;That brewages housing 20 is provided above gondola water faucet 17, gondola water faucet 17 and second Hot-water line 3 connects;Brewage the top of housing 20 to be provided with at least one in brewageing housing 20, inject liquid Apopore 30.
The bottom brewageing housing 20 is Coffee outlet 34, and coffee cup is placed on the body below Coffee outlet 34 On base.
Body 1 includes and is arranged on the capping 18 brewageed above housing 20, capping 18 and brewage housing 20 and wrap Enclosing formation coffee brewing chamber 19, gondola water faucet 17 is fixed on the top of capping 18.
Coffee bean capsule 21, includes container-like shell, and the inner chamber of shell is that coffee bean accommodates chamber;Described Cutterhead 23 includes the pricker 27 for puncturing coffee bean capsule shell.
Propulsive mechanism 31 includes handle 13, connecting rod 14 and axle sleeve 15, handle 13 the most successively Connect by the way of handle fulcrum 12 uses convenient rotation with connecting rod 14;Body is stretched out in the outer end of handle 13 1 is outside;The upper end of axle sleeve 15 is fastenedly connected with connecting rod 14, and lower end connects perforation and milling cutter parts 29 Rotating shaft 22, rotating shaft 22 and axle sleeve 15 use the mode not rotated coaxially to connect;Rotating shaft 22 is provided with one Coaxial groove 33, rotating shaft 22 is fixed in groove 33 restriction rotating shaft by pin 16 after inserting axle sleeve 15 22 and axle sleeve 15 play in axial direction.
During work, described perforation and milling cutter parts 29 be arranged to can to charge into and exit described in brewage housing 20 In, perforation and milling cutter parts are disposed substantially at other of capsule coffee basket or the top of housing or side Center, direction, described perforation and milling cutter parts 29 can grind the coffee bean capsule having envelope paper above, The coffee bean capsule without envelope paper can be ground again.Coffee bean capsule 21 is placed on to be brewageed in housing 20 inner chamber, and Pierce through coffee bean capsule surface 25 at least one operating position and allow mill bean motor 9, driving gear 10 And driven gear 11 drives described rotating shaft 22 to drive perforation and milling cutter parts 29 to rotate, ground coffee Bean 26, described water inlet 30 drenches in being arranged to the capsule 21 being punctured in the described upper direction brewageing housing 20 Spill liquid.
In Fig. 2, perforation and milling cutter parts 29 are positioned at initial position A, in Fig. 1, bore a hole and grind Knife milling tool parts 29 are positioned at abrasion site B, perforation and milling cutter parts 29 by initial position A to grinding The propulsive mechanism 31 that moves through of position B has pushed down on, and propulsive mechanism 31 is made up of bar and axle Linkage, the handle 13 of propulsive mechanism 31 also has two abrasion sites, such as extended position C in Fig. 2 and Such as the depressing position D in Fig. 1, the most corresponding perforation and the initial position A of milling cutter parts 29 and grinding Position B.The axle sleeve 15 of propulsive mechanism 31 connects perforation and the rotating shaft 22 of milling cutter parts 29, rotating shaft 22 The layout not rotated coaxially, axle sleeve 15 when i.e. perforation and milling cutter parts 29 turn is used with axle sleeve 15 Will not follow rotation, in figure 6, rotating shaft 22 has a coaxial groove 33, and axle sleeve is inserted in rotating shaft 22 Rotating shaft 22 and axle sleeve 15 play in axial direction is limited by pin 16 after 15.Such as Fig. 5, bore a hole and grind Knife milling tool parts 29 have pricker 27, and it can puncture the surface 25 of capsule 21, put into capsule 21 to making After making housing 20, driving handle 13, to depressing position D is then bored a hole and milling cutter portion from extended position C Part 29 moves to abrasion site B from initial position A, and now perforation and milling cutter parts 29 have pierced through The surface 25 of capsule 21, cutterhead 23 is imbedded the coffee bean 26 in capsule 21, is ground bean motor 9 and pass through gear 10,11 driving perforation and milling cutter parts 29 high speed rotating, the coffee bean 26 in capsule 21 is by cutterhead 23 are chopped into coffee powder.After completing said process, the water in water tank 2 is heated and passes through by hot-water heating system 28 Water pipe 3 is to entering to gondola water faucet 17, and gondola water faucet 17 has the effect of injection, and gondola water faucet 17 is by being distributed on bottom it Hot water is sprayed to the coffee powder brewageed in housing 20 below with brewing coffee by apopore 30, brewages Coffee is flowed into by the Coffee outlet 34 of housing bottom and is positioned over the coffee cup 24 brewageed below housing 20.When During above-mentioned hot water sprays to coffee, due to the layout of apopore 30 with the position of cutterhead 23, hot water can To clean the surface of cutterhead 23 simultaneously.After completing whole brewing process, driving handle 13 is from depressing position D To extended position C, then perforation and milling cutter parts 29 move to initial position A from abrasion site B, this Shi Kecong takes out the coffee grounds remained and the shell of the capsule 21 being utilized in brewageing housing 20.
